On This Day in Music History 5th March 1965

On this day in Music history, The Mannish Boys released their second single ‘I Pity The Fool’and while it might seem like a small footnote in music history, it actually captures two future legends right at the very start of their journeys.
On vocals is a 17-year-old David Bowie, still performing under his real name Davy Jones. At this point, Bowie was experimenting, searching for identity, and moving through early bands after his time with The King Bees, where he released “Liza Jane.”. He hadn’t yet found the sound, style, or persona that would later change music forever but you can already hear the ambition.
Just a few years later, he would reinvent himself completely, creating Ziggy Stardust and becoming one of the most influential artists of all time constantly evolving through personas, sounds, and eras, from glam rock to soul, Berlin electronica and beyond.
And on guitar? None other than Jimmy Page, still a teenage session player at the time. Before forming Led Zeppelin, Page was quietly shaping the sound of the 60s behind the scenes, playing on countless recordings while remaining largely unknown to the public.
So this one record is a snapshot of a moment before fame Bowie still discovering who he was, and Page still anonymous… both on the brink of greatness.
